Choosing The Right Typing Course For Your Kids!

The ability to type quickly and accurately is crucial for every day life. We live in a computer world. From the server in a restaurant to a CEO of a Fortune 500, typing skills are necessary. Typing is a useful, life-long skill. The better your typing skills, the more opportunities that will available to you.

Typing skills are just as important for children. Prepare your children for the computer age. Teach them when they are young (if they can tie their own shoes, they are ready), and typing will become second nature to them.

Everything will be a lot easier for your children if they learn correct typing techniques with proper finger placement and movement, and without looking at the keyboard. It will help them with school work starting as early as elementary school. Typing speed will affect how fast they can do research, surf the Web, write papers, and save time with school work! Typing has been shown to improve spelling, writing, language skills, and grades.

You could let your children teach themselves how to type... but they will develop bad habits that will plague them their whole life. Or you can choose a scientifically-sound typing course.

Here are a few criteria to look when choosing a typing course.

* Provides fast results.

* Makes it fun and easy to learn and practice so the child will eagerly participate, which eliminates frustration.

* Uses natural, effective learning methods that work and eliminates the frustration associated with traditional typing methods.

* Reinforces proven teaching methods with clever exercises, leading to immediate and continuing gratification results

* Lays the foundation of proper finger placement and movement. Shortcuts always lead to disaster.

* Provides the ability to learn at the child's own level and pace.

* Customizable so the child can work on weak typing areas.

Rote memorization is uninteresting and has a high failure rate. Researchers give us clues to the workings of the brain, and how we learn and remember. Kids have rich imaginations. When choosing a typing course, choose one that use these revolutionary mind, visualization and memory connections. Don't fight nature. Tap into these natural learning tools to pique your children's interest and keep them focused on the task, learning how to type. If you take advantage of how the mind really works, you will find that they will master typing skills in a fast, fun and enthusiastic way.

Finding an effective typing course for your kids is important. When your children learn the correct finger placement with proven learning methods, drills and activities, their accuracy and speed will improve and they will be prepared for the fast-paced computer-oriented world of today.
